It’s happened to all of us: you’re minding your own business at work and then suddenly, you smell something similar to onions. Your first thought? “Ugh. Something stinks.” Then you smell it in the next room and you find yourself having to second-guess your own hygiene. “Wait? Is that me?” So you fake yawn, lean your head to the side and discover that the not-so-fresh smell emanating is actually coming from you.

A tart odor catches everyone by surprise at one time or another, and sometimes it has nothing to do with the time of your last shower. Certain foods can leave you smelling “off,” especially when the weather warms up. So if you have a date, a long day or a crowded hot yoga class at the gym ahead of you, it may be helpful to avoid these foods and dietary changes. Or, if you can’t, at least be prepared with a little perfume, powder or baby wipes on hand.
